如何在Java中使用Elasticsearch的官方客户端实现文件选择器与搜索引擎的整合?请提供具体的代码示例。
时间: 2024-10-28 18:04:52 浏览: 16
为了整合Java中的文件选择器与Elasticsearch搜索引擎,首先需要确保你已经安装并运行了Elasticsearch服务。接下来,通过Java代码引入Elasticsearch官方客户端库,并编写代码实现文件选择器与Elasticsearch的交互。具体步骤如下:
参考资源链接:[Java开发源码:文件选择器源代码包](https://wenku.csdn.net/doc/1oz5h0cryg?spm=1055.2569.3001.10343)
1. 引入Elasticsearch客户端依赖项:
在项目的pom.xml文件中添加Elasticsearch官方客户端依赖:
```xml
<dependency>
<groupId>org.elasticsearch.client</groupId>
<artifactId>elasticsearch-rest-high-level-client</artifactId>
<version>7.10.0</version> <!-- 使用最新的客户端版本 -->
</dependency>
```
2. 初始化Elasticsearch客户端:
```java
RestHighLevelClient client = new RestHighLevelClient(
RestClient.builder(new HttpHost(
参考资源链接:[Java开发源码:文件选择器源代码包](https://wenku.csdn.net/doc/1oz5h0cryg?spm=1055.2569.3001.10343)
阅读全文